VUWCTF 2025
December 6, 2025 at 9:00 AM - December 7, 2025 at 5:00 PM | Kelburn Campus & Online
Our flagship event of the year! Compete in our weekend-long Capture The Flag competition featuring challenges across multiple domains including reverse engineering, binary exploitation, web exploitation, forensics, hardware, cryptography, and OSINT. Challenges will be available for beginners through advanced participants, making this perfect for everyone from curious newcomers to experienced security enthusiasts.
Timing note: in-person event starts at 9am, CTF starts at 10am

NZCSC
July 11, 2025 at 9:00 AM - July 17, 2025 at 5:00 PM | Online
The NZ Cybersecurity Challenge is a well established CTF competition organised by Waikato University. It's a great competition for beginners, with many easy challenges and several harder ones. We plan to enter the competition with the prefix "VuwCTF" to establish ourselves.
